Goat Cuddles FAQ's

What's included with a goat cuddles session?

During your visit, you’ll get an hour of quality time with our baby goats and their mamas. After your session, you are welcome to stay and explore the farm - we have tons of awesome animals who would love to meet you! Please note: animal pens are closed to visitors during goat cuddles. 

The farm closes at 6 PM. For parking management, we cannot allow reentry to the farm after a party leaves. Children must be supervised by their adults at all times. 

I saw the limit is 6 guests. Can I bring an extra guest? Can we rotate additional guests in and out of the pen so everyone can visit?

Group goat cuddles sessions are limited to 6 guests total - adults and children 2 and up included. Group sizes are limited because of space considerations and to reduce stress on our babies. We try to keep traffic in and out of stalls to a minimum for the same reason.

 

Sometimes we are able to accommodate a very limited number of additional guests for a fee - these requests are handled on a case by case basis. We recommend booking an additional group slot if you anticipate going over the 6 guest limit.

What else should I be aware of?

Our babies' immune systems are still developing. For this reason, all guests must step through a boot wash (a diluted bleach solution) before entering the barn or the maternity pasture. Please wear closed toed shoes. 

We recommend that you leave anything that you don’t need to have with you in your vehicle during your session. Baby goats are curious and try to munch on everything. ​
